Hooray! Get your taste buds ready to embark on a delectable journey. I have great news for you, Katherine. All you need to enjoy the festivities of the Disney California Adventure Food & Wine Festival are a valid
theme park ticket and
theme park reservation for Disney California Adventure Park. After that, all that's left is to decide what to do, and more importantly, what to eat.
My favorite way to enjoy the
Festival Marketplaces is with a
Sip and Savor Pass. You can use this pass to sample many of the mouthwatering eats at the festival booths. You can even split and share the pass with a friend and you don't have to use it all in one day. You can also come back and use your remaining tabs throughout the duration of the festival. Here's a fun quick tip for you. You can order all of your eats at one Festival Marketplace booth (I like to find the shortest ordering line) and then use your receipt to pick up your items at their respective booths. Less time waiting in line means more time to eat and enjoy the entertainment! Just be sure that you only purchase the handful of items that you can collect and eat for the day. This feature is also not always available, but check with a Cast Member when you're ready to order.
The food is fantastic, however, it's not the only star of the festival. There are culinary demonstrations that you can watch (check the
Disneyland app for showtimes) and even live music on the Palisades Stage. When I recently visited, I enjoyed the music of "Phat Cat Swinger" on the stage with the backdrop of Pixar Pier. I would also be remiss if I didn't recommend taking a flight on
Soarin' Over California. It's only available for a limited time during the festival and is my favorite version of this attraction.
